Canon 300D vs Canon 4000D Overview
Below is a detailed assessment of the Canon 300D and Canon 4000D, both Entry-Level DSLR cameras and they are both manufactured by Canon. There exists a crucial gap among the resolutions of the 300D (6MP) and 4000D (18MP) but they use the same exact sensor measurements (APS-C).

The 300D was brought out 15 years prior to the 4000D and that is a fairly serious gap as far as camera technology is concerned. Both the cameras offer the identical body type (Compact SLR).

Canon 300D vs Canon 4000D Physical Comparison
For those who are planning to lug around your camera often, you'll have to factor its weight and volume. The Canon 300D offers physical dimensions of 142mm x 99mm x 72mm (5.6" x 3.9" x 2.8") accompanied by a weight of 645 grams (1.42 lbs) whilst the Canon 4000D has sizing of 129mm x 102mm x 77mm (5.1" x 4.0" x 3.0") accompanied by a weight of 436 grams (0.96 lbs).

Canon 300D vs Canon 4000D Sensor Comparison
More often than not, it is tough to picture the gap in sensor measurements just by looking through technical specs. The photograph below will offer you a much better sense of the sensor sizes in the 300D and 4000D.
As you can tell, the two cameras enjoy the same exact sensor sizing albeit different MP. You should expect the Canon 4000D to provide you with extra detail having its extra 12 Megapixels. Higher resolution will also enable you to crop photographs far more aggressively. The older 300D will be behind when it comes to sensor innovation.
